Adjusting striker pin
   
Adjusting striker pin
  Note
t  Threaded plate -1- of striker pin is secured in pillar using a method which differs from the previous method.
t  Bow outside of threaded plate is welded firmly to pillar. Webs to threaded plate are plastically deformable.
t  Increased forced must be applied so that striker pin -2- can be adjusted with bolts -3- loosened.

  Note
t  The door must lock fully when closing without any additional force being required and must not have any play.
t  The door must not be pushed up or down due to striker pin adjustment.
The following can be adjusted at the striker pin:
l  When the front door does not align with the rear door or side panel
   
–  Loosen striker pin -1- by loosening bolts -2- in B-pillar.
–  Adjust the front door with the striker pin -1- so that the front door is flush with the rear door or side panel when shut (to prevent wind noise).
–  Tighten bolts -2- of striker pin -1-.
Specified torque for bolts -2-: 20 Nm.
